Understanding how the instruments<br />
are set up<br />
World Inspire Sets<br />
One of the great things about this library<br />
are the “World Inspire Sets”. They can be<br />
found in the “Projects” drop down menu.<br />
With a hit of a key you can have an epic<br />
drum ensemble play. If you like, you can<br />
create your own grooves as well.<br />
A World Inspire Set consists of multiple<br />
“Layers”. Each Layer is a different drum/<br />
instrument. The concept behind a World<br />
Inspire Set is to provide a variety of<br />
inspiring drum combinations and grooves.<br />
All Sets except one, have grooves<br />
assigned to keys on the keyboard.<br />
In the picture to the right, you can see the Layer area. You can load more Layers, by<br />
clicking Add Layer. 1 Layer = 1 drum/instrument.<br />

How do I load and choose a drum/<br />
instrument?<br />
Before you can load a drum, you need to decide on the version you want to use.<br />
1. Full RR, Medium RR, and Small RR versions. The difference between<br />
these versions is the amount of round-robin. The more round-robin, the more realistic<br />
the performance. Round-robin refers to the process of cycling through multiple alternate<br />
samples/recordings of a particular hit type creating a more human feel. For example,<br />
an instrument with 7 microphones, 5 velocities, 10 round robin, and 15 hit types<br />
would equal to 5,250 samples. So loading an instrument with less round-robin will<br />
substantially decrease the sample count.<br />
Most instruments in the Full RR version consist of 10 round-robin, Medium RR = 5,<br />
Small RR = 2. With this in mind, if your system is struggling with the Full RR version you<br />
can load the Medium RR or Small RR version.<br />
